Description

'Map of the Frontier between Gold Coast and Togoland by the Boundary Commission 1904' (territory covered is now in Ghana). On 2 sheets: (7) sheet II; (8) sheet I. Compass indicator to item 7. Signed: Lieutenant A E Coningham, Royal Engineers, British Commissioner, and Leutnant Baron von Seefried, German Commissioner.
